Dan Haar: MGM to buy Empire City in Yonkers, will still pursue Bridgeport

MGM Resorts International has reached a deal to buy the Empire City Casino in Yonkers, N.Y., a move that will turbocharge the Las Vegas-based gaming company’s northeast expansion with a coveted metro New York property and roil the debate over commercial casinos in Connecticut. MGM Resorts and its affiliated real estate company will pay $850 million, including the assumption of about $245 million in debt, for the casino at the site of Yonkers Raceway — just 16 miles from the Connecticut line at Greenwich and 16 miles from midtown Manhattan. Operations include 5,000 slot machines, some restaurants and a full schedule of harness racing, which MGM executives said they intend to continue.
